По какому принципу организованы файловые системы
Дисковая среда образует собой механизм, он используется для хранение, упорядочивание и обращение до информации в пределах компьютерном накопителе. Она регулирует, как именно объекты располагаются внутри носителе, каким образом формируются директории, как осуществляется Покердом чтение, сохранение, копирование и стирание сведений. При отсутствии файловой структуры устройство хранения являлось бы совокупностью блоков памяти без наличия логичной организации.
Внутри цифровой экосистеме системная система берет на себя роль организатора данных. Расширенные материалы, подобные как pokerdom, помогают систематизировать представление того, как именно данные фиксируется, каталогизируется и считывается. Ключевое значение уделяется схеме сохранения, быстроте обращения, надежности и регулированию доступов.
Функции файловой структуры
Главная функция файловой структуры — создать комфортную обращение со информацией. Оператор или программа отображает объекты, директории, названия и типы, при этом непосредственно система регулирует физическим Pokerdom расположением информации в пределах диске. Это помогает работать с файлами, изображениями, программами и техническими данными без необходимости непосредственного доступа к блокам диска.
Системная система дополнительно отвечает за структуру. Система содержит информацию касательно того, в каком месте размещен любой файл, каков для объекта вес, в какой момент он был добавлен а также какого типа права доступа до файлу применяются. Благодаря этому рабочая система способна быстро обнаруживать требуемые файлы а также проверять операции со данными.
Еще одна ключевая роль — страховка от исчезновения сведений. Современные дисковые системы задействуют журналы, запасные области Покердом официальный сайт а также валидации неповрежденности. Указанные механизмы дают возможность восстановить сведения по окончании сбоя энергоснабжения, сбоя фиксации либо некорректного завершения работы.
Документы и директории
Документ выступает главной единицей хранения сведений. Объект имеет возможность содержать текстовые данные, изображение, видеофайл, программу, архив а также служебную информацию. Каждый документ содержит обозначение, размер, формат и расположение внутри структуры Покердом сбережения.
Папки используются для сортировки файлов. Каталоги создают систему, в которой информация распределяются по директориям и дополнительным разделам. Подобный способ облегчает навигацию и помогает разделять данные на основе направлениям, проектам, типам либо срокам.
На внутреннем плане каталог кроме того является служебной формой сведений. Объект содержит информацию касательно файлах а также внутренних папках. Если платформа открывает папку, система читает такие данные и показывает перечень имеющихся Pokerdom объектов.
Служебные данные документов
Дополнительные сведения — это служебная сведения про файле. Метаданные показывают не содержимое, а параметры файла. К числу дополнительным сведениям относятся вес, время формирования, момент обновления, пользователь, права обращения, тип файла и расположение участков сведений.
Системная платформа задействует служебные данные для управления документами. К примеру, в процессе сортировке с учетом времени среда обращается не к содержимому Покердом официальный сайт документа, а к его внутренним параметрам. В процессе контроле допуска кроме того проверяются метаданные.
Служебные данные позволяют повысить работу со крупным объемом документов. Без наличия метаданных платформе нужно было бы бы всякий случай полным образом анализировать наполнение документов, это значительно снизило бы осуществление операций.
Размещение данных в пределах носителе
Дисковая система делит носитель по блоки или группы. В момент когда создается файл, данное Покердом наполнение записывается в один а также несколько таких секторов. Когда документ малый, он имеет возможность заполнять один сектор. Если файл крупный, данные распределяются по многим блокам.
Кластеры не постоянно расположены подряд. При частом создании, редактировании и исключении объектов доступное место размещается неровно. В результате отдельный объект имеет возможность стать разбит на фрагменты, расположенные в различных областях диска Pokerdom.
Данное состояние именуется фрагментацией. Внутри механических накопителях она может замедлять темп чтения, поскольку что физическим механизмам нужно обращаться к разным секторам диска. Внутри современных твердотельных дисках влияние разбиения ниже, при этом грамотное сохранение сведений все равно равно является актуальным.
Структуры сохранения и индексы
Для того чтобы находить сведения, системная среда использует отдельные Покердом официальный сайт таблицы и индексы. Внутри них фиксируется сведения касательно факта, какие именно блоки связаны определенному файлу. В момент когда программа считывает объект, система сперва переходит к таким служебным данным.
В рамках элементарных файловых структурах задействуется схема сохранения документов. Таблица показывает порядок секторов а также помогает восстановить документ на основе разных частей. Внутри более продвинутых системах задействуются реестры, иерархии а также иные схемы с целью оптимизации нахождения.
Каталогизация наиболее значима при работе с значительным числом информации. Насколько скорее система получает Покердом метаданные а также секторы файла, настолько оперативнее выполняются операции чтения, сохранения и поиска.
Права доступа
Файловая структура проверяет, какой пользователь может открывать, изменять либо стирать файлы. Ради данной задачи используются уровни допуска. Разрешения могут задаваться относительно автора объекта, группы пользователей либо всех элементов платформы.
Стандартные разрешения как правило содержат чтение, запись и выполнение. Открытие помогает изучать содержимое, изменение — изменять информацию, запуск — открывать объект в качестве скрипт Pokerdom или скрипт. Для работы с каталогов указанные права имеют дополнительные особенности, связанные со просмотром и редактированием наполнения каталога.
Контроль прав помогает сохранить сведения от непреднамеренного стирания и постороннего изменения. В рамках многопользовательских платформах это в особенности важно, так что отдельные участники способны взаимодействовать с общим и тем же ресурсом.
Логирование дисковой системы
Журналирование задействуется ради повышения стабильности. Накануне выполнением критичных действий системная среда сохраняет информацию о намеченных операциях на служебный журнал. Когда случается ошибка, реестр дает возможность Покердом официальный сайт установить, какие именно процедуры были выполнены, а какого типа не были завершены.
Данный подход уменьшает опасность нарушения организации сохранения. К примеру, если файл переносился внутри момент сбоя электропитания, журнал дает возможность восстановить согласованное состояние среды.
Ведение журнала никак не обязательно сохраняет основное содержимое файла против исчезновения, но позволяет обеспечить целостность внутренних структур. Это важно для обеспечения надежной деятельности операционной платформы и предотвращения серьезных нарушений сохранения.
Форматирование а также создание файловой структуры
Перед подключением носителя чаще всего осуществляется форматирование. Внутри рамках этого процесса формируется схема Покердом системной структуры: реестры, служебные зоны, главный каталог и настройки сохранения данных.
Форматирование имеет возможность выполняться ускоренным а также полным. Быстрое подготовка создает чистую структуру без полного стирания любых сведений. Полное форматирование кроме того проверяет состояние диска а также способно занимать значительнее времени.
Выбор дисковой среды формируется исходя из носителя а также задач. Некоторые форматы эффективнее подходят под основных разделов, иные — для нужд дополнительных носителей, карт сохранения или сочетаемости среди отдельными системными системами.
Типы дисковых систем
Используется множество распространенных файловых систем. NTFS часто задействуется на системах Windows а также предоставляет права доступа, логирование и обращение с объемными файлами. FAT32 отличается широкой сочетаемостью, однако содержит лимиты по весу Pokerdom документа.
exFAT обычно задействуется для съемных устройств и съемных накопителей, поскольку как обеспечивает объемные объекты а также работает со разными системами. На Linux распространены ext4 и другие файловые системы, рассчитанные под стабильность и гибкую обращение с доступами.
Отдельная системная система обладает свои достоинства и лимиты. Следовательно решение формируется исходя из объема данных, условий к надежности, быстроте функционирования и совместимости с платформами.
Буферизация при работе с файлами
Буферизация помогает оптимизировать действия чтения а также сохранения. Платформа временно сохраняет часто применяемые информацию в быстрой памяти, с целью не переходить к носителю всякий случай. Данный механизм наиболее актуально в процессе очередном просмотре одних и тех же объектов.
Во время записи данные имеют возможность сперва попадать внутрь кэш, и потом фиксироваться в пределах носитель. Подобный подход Покердом официальный сайт увеличивает темп обработки, при этом нуждается в корректного завершения процедур. Когда электропитание исчезнет до сохранения в пределах диск, доля сведений может быть потеряна.
Из-за этого рабочие платформы используют инструменты обновления. Системы периодически записывают информацию с временной памяти в пределах накопитель а также сохраняют изменения. Это позволяет объединять скорость и стабильность.
Ошибки и нарушения системной структуры
Системная структура способна ломаться вследствие отключений энергоснабжения, сбоев аппаратуры, ошибочного удаления диска либо системных сбоев. Сбой способно затронуть конкретные файлы, каталоги либо внутренние таблицы.
Ради проверки применяются отдельные утилиты. Они анализируют структуры, индексы, связи между блоками а также дополнительные сведения. В случае если выявлены ошибки, система пытается получить согласованное положение.
Не все повреждения можно восстановить целиком. Из-за этого важную функцию играет страховое копирование. Даже если устойчивая файловая система не заменяет регулярное сохранение важных информации внутри отдельном месте.
Производительность файловой структуры
Скорость обработки дисковой среды формируется исходя из категории накопителя, размера кластеров, количества файлов, показателя фрагментации и метода каталогизации. Значительное количество мелких документов имеет возможность считываться менее быстро, чем множество больших элементов аналогичного же итогового объема.
Производительность кроме того зависит от модели применения. Для отдельных задач значима быстрота линейного чтения, для выполнения прочих — быстрый обращение до случайным фрагментам сведений. Следовательно отдельные файловые структуры могут демонстрировать различные показатели внутри разных условиях.
Оптимизация предполагает правильный подбор формата, систематическую оценку состояния диска, проверку доступного объема и грамотную организацию директорий. Эти процедуры помогают сохранять стабильную скорость обработки.